How to Fix a Sunroof That Leaks During Spring Showers?

A sunroof is a great feature to have—until it starts leaking. While it’s designed to keep out rain and debris, water can sometimes find its way into your car, leading to stains, mold, and electrical issues. If you’ve noticed wet spots on your seats or headliner after a rainy day, it’s time to address the problem before it causes serious damage. Sunroof leaks are more common than you might think, but the good news is that they are often fixable without major repairs. Identifying the cause early can save you from costly water damage inside your vehicle. Why Your Sunroof Might Be Leaking A leaky sunroof isn’t necessarily a sign of a broken part. In most cases, leaks happen because water isn’t draining properly or because the seal around the sunroof has worn out over time. How Long Do Brake Pads and Rotors Last?

Your car’s braking system is one of the most important safety features, ensuring you can stop effectively when needed. But brakes don’t last forever. Over time, both brake pads and rotors wear down due to constant friction, and knowing when to replace them can help prevent safety risks and costly breakdowns. While there isn’t a set lifespan that applies to every vehicle, several factors influence how long your brake components will last. For drivers in Sherman Oaks, CA, frequent stop-and-go traffic, hilly terrain, and urban driving conditions can all impact brake wear. Knowing the signs of brake wear and taking proactive steps to maintain your braking system can keep your vehicle performing at its best. How Long Do Brake Pads Last Brake pads typically last between 30,000 and 40,000 miles, but the exact lifespan depends on several factors, including driving habits, road conditions, and the type of brake pads installed. Top 5 Areas That Need Attention on Your Mini Cooper

Owning a Mini Cooper means embracing a car with unique style, sporty handling, and a reputation for fun. But like any vehicle, your Mini Cooper has its quirks and specific areas that require regular attention to keep it running at its best. Whether you're navigating the streets of Sherman Oaks, CA, or cruising the highway, staying on top of maintenance is key to a long-lasting and reliable ride. 1. Timing Chain Tensioner One common issue Mini Cooper owners encounter is problems with the timing chain tensioner. Over time, this component can wear out or loosen, leading to a rattling noise from the engine. Left unchecked, a failing tensioner can cause the timing chain to jump, potentially resulting in severe engine damage. Why Do My Headlights Look Cloudy, and Can They Be Fixed?

Ever noticed that your headlights look hazy or yellowish? Cloudy headlights are not only an eyesore, but they can also be a safety hazard, reducing the amount of light they emit and making it harder for you to see the road clearly at night. If you’re wondering why your headlights have turned cloudy and what you can do about it, you’re not alone. Many car owners face this issue, especially as their vehicles age. We'll explain why headlights get that foggy look and what can be done to restore their clarity. The Causes of Cloudy Headlights When headlights look cloudy, it’s usually due to a process called oxidation. Modern headlights are typically made from polycarbonate plastic, a durable material designed to withstand minor impacts and general wear and tear. Why Is My Steering Wheel Hard to Turn?

Have you ever gotten into your car, all set for your drive, only to find that your steering wheel feels stiff and hard to turn? It's not just an inconvenience—it can be a safety risk. Difficulty turning your steering wheel can make driving stressful and dangerous. Whether you're having trouble with tight corners or navigating straight roads, it's important to know the causes of this issue and how to deal with it. Low Power Steering Fluid One of the most common reasons for a hard-to-turn steering wheel is low power steering fluid. Your car's power steering system relies on hydraulic fluid to make turning easier. When there isn’t enough fluid in the system, the steering wheel becomes stiff, particularly when turning at low speeds or while parking. Low fluid can occur due to leaks or natural wear and tear over time. If your fluid is leaking, it must be addressed immediately. What Makes Maserati's Past, Present, and Future So Remarkable?

When it comes to luxury sports cars, few names evoke the same sense of passion, elegance, and performance as Maserati. From its storied past to its innovative present and ambitious future, Maserati stands as a symbol of automotive excellence. But what exactly makes Maserati so remarkable? Let's dive into the captivating journey of this iconic brand and discover the elements that set it apart. A Storied Past Steeped in Racing Heritage Maserati's history is a tale of triumph, innovation, and relentless pursuit of speed. Founded in 1914 by the Maserati brothers in Bologna, Italy, the brand quickly made a name for itself in the competitive world of motor racing. With its first racing car, the Tipo 26, Maserati began to dominate the racing circuits, winning the prestigious Targa Florio in 1926.
